Let’s stay close to home this week. These are easy trails with lots of shade or coastal breezes.
Narrated by Tom Henschel, the Hotline offers weekly on-line and recorded updates on the best locations for viewing spring wildflowers in Southern and Central California. All locations are on easily accessible public lands and range from urban to wild, distant to right here in L.A.
